Dracophyllum subulatum, commonly known as monoao,[3] is a species of tree or shrub in the heath family Ericaceae.
It reaches a height of 0.3–2.0 m (0.98–6.56 ft) and has waved leaves, which look like narrow grass, with many thin stalks.
The colour of mature leaves is olive to dark green.
It is endemic to the North Island of New Zealand, from Rotorua to Taihape, living in low-lying areas between volcanoes, shrubland, and tussock grassland in altitudes from 100 to 1,200m.
[4][5] They are facilitators, protecting native species from frosts, therefore encouraging plant biodiversity.
